Megan Broome/The Clayton Tribune. Board of Education Chairman Steve Cabe, left, presents an award to Tax Commissioner Sandy Smith at last Thursday’s meeting. The award was presented on behalf of Board of Education members to thank Smith for her hard work during her career. Her department’s tax collections contribute to the amount of funding Rabun County Schools receives, Superintendent April Childers explained. Smith is retiring at the end of the year.
